Job Description
We are looking for a qualified and experienced Guard Supervisor to lead our team of security personnel. The ideal candidate must possess strong leadership and communication skills to ensure the safety and security of our facilities. This role involves overseeing daily operations, implementing security protocols, and training security staff. Join us and be part of a dedicated team that values professionalism and safety.

Job Responsibilities
  • Lead the daily operations of the security team, ensuring all protocols are followed.
  • Implement security measures that address potential threats.
  • Monitor security equipment and enforce policies regarding its use.
  • Train staff on emergency response techniques and procedures.
  • Investigate security breaches and develop preventive measures.
  • Maintain relationships with clients and attend to their security needs.
  • Establish a reporting system for all security matters.
  • Ensure a professional and proactive approach to security concerns.
  • Communicate regularly with management on security issues and updates.
